matlab定义字母为任意常数
答:NaN他是Not a NUmber的简写。那么对于Nan怎么造成的,或者什么情况下才会产生这个,下面的目的的就是操作下,这样可以方便对于这些数据产生的来源,从而加深我们对于它的理解。0/0 或者说 任意常数/0 也就是0不能做分母。 这与我们平常的计算规则是一致的。对于这种情况可以用一个很小的数来代替0。例...
答:在matlab中,我们可以使用e来表示恒等式e^x=exp(x),其中x是任意实数。e还与复数有关,它在极坐标下的表示是e^(θ*i),其中i是虚数单位,θ是极角,可以用matlab中的polar函数来表示。e是matlab中广泛使用的一个数学常数,它常被用于指数函数。比如,如果我们要求2的e次幂,可以在matlab中输入2^...
答:作为一个文本框,就可以设置为0.532,也可以设置它为1.064和1.5了, 为什么要用设置成按钮呢?
答:C是任意常数。而小字的c是你的系数。C6在其实也就是常数C。在执行这个语句前,你先clear一下试度
答:因为这是一阶微分方程,C1就是待定常数!如果有初始值,C1就确定了!
答:在matlab中exp意思是以自然常数e为底的指数函数。返回 e(自然对数的底)的幂次方。所属库为math.h,用法是double exp(double number)。number 参数可以是任意有效的数值表达式。即exp(0) 就等于1,exp(1) 就等于e,exp(2) 就等于 e²,exp(3) 就等于 e³。
答:1、首先在电脑中打开MATLAB软件,如下图所示。2、然后定义相关的变量和函数,t=0:0.01:3*pi;x=cos(t);y=sin(t),如下图所示。3、接着采用plot3指令画这个曲线;plot3(x,y,t),如下图所示。4、最后运行程序,查看曲线结果,如下图所示就完成了。
答:clear % 清除matlab工作内存 lam=500e-9; %定义一个常数λ: 500乘以10的-9次方 a=1e-3;D=1; %定义常数a:10的-3次方;常数D=1 ym=3*lam*D/a; %定义ym ny=51; %定义取点个数 ny=51 ys=linspace(-ym,ym,ny); %定义一个数组ys,从-ym到ym之间取ny个点 np...
答:先用dsolve 不行的话ODE
答:如何用matlab求解微分方程xy'+y=x^2+3x+2的通解?第一步,对y(x)进行变量声明 syms y(x)第二步,对y(x)求导函数 Dy=diff(y)第三步,使用dsolve函数,求解其微分方程的通解 y=dsolve(x*Dy+y==x^2+3*x+2)运行结果如下
网友评论:
容歪18987546306:
matlab里怎么定义某字母为常量? -
50656暨先
: syms t w diff(sin(w*t),t) 应该是这样写
容歪18987546306:
在matlab中,如何定义函数式子中的未知常数.即,在做某个迭代程序时,函数中含有未知常数(用字母表示),而在最终的结果又想要用含有该未知常数的式... -
50656暨先
:[答案] 有个定义符号变量的函数楼主可能不知: syms是定义符号变量的函数 syms a 之后a就可以直接当做一个变量使用了,而不在乎它的取值,也就是符号变量.当然由此运行的结果肯定会包含a,运算出来的结果也是符号变量. 如多个变量需要定义,则可...
容歪18987546306:
matlab 二元非线性方程 -
50656暨先
: 首先,定义变量,只要在你的方程中出现的变量,包括字母常量,都要定义,我给你举一个例子吧, 比如:x^2+u*x+x*y=0v*y^2+x*y=0 此处,x,y为变量,u,v为字母常量 定义变量的方法: (注:如果没有字母常量,只定义变量就可以) syms x y...
容歪18987546306:
matlab 如何规定常数,比如求求sin(w*t)的导数时,w是常数,t为变量,怎么定义w -
50656暨先
: >> syms w t >> f=sin(w*t)f =sin(w*t)>> f1=diff(f,'t')f1 =cos(w*t)*w>> 求导时候,指出来对谁求导就行了,剩下的会自动当做常量处理.
容歪18987546306:
matlab怎样解含有字母常量的方程组?
50656暨先
: 仍然和没有字母一样,直接用solve.例如 syms x y a solve('y-a*x=0',y) 结果是 a*x
容歪18987546306:
matlab 可以定义一个常数a,a的范围是0<a<1吗? -
50656暨先
: 如果是常数就不能变,你只能定义成变量
容歪18987546306:
matlab怎么定义常量? -
50656暨先
: 还是使用global,比如说想添加一个PII, 值为3.566. 方法1:修改系统文件matlabrc.m(命名时注意不要造成混乱). 找到你的安装目录下的启动文件matlabrc.m,例如: C:\matlab\toolbox\local\matlabrc.m 打开,并且在最后一行添加: global PII;...
容歪18987546306:
matlab怎样解含有字母常量的方程组? -
50656暨先
: 假设a为常量,举个例子.clc; clear all; close all; syms a x eq = a + x^2 - x; solve(eq, x)结果 ans = (1 - 4*a)^(1/2)/2 + 1/21/2 - (1 - 4*a)^(1/2)/2>> 或者clc; clear all; close all; eq = 'a + x^2 - x'; solve(eq, 'x')
容歪18987546306:
matlab 中有没有像C语言中宏定义(#define)的功能 -
50656暨先
: C语言中定义a为常量100#define a 100 MATLAB中定义 global a; a=100;
容歪18987546306:
matlab如何定义(声明)常量? -
50656暨先
: Matlab中没有必要申明,除非特殊变量,比如符号变量常量,只要你不修改它就可以了“为防止被无意修改”这个好像Matlab没有这个功能